Laboratorio Informática II Clase 5 Excel Controles Active X Repaso Macros.

Slides:



Advertisements
Presentaciones similares
PROGRAMACIÓN CON VISUAL BASIC.
Advertisements

Nicole Chung. Ejercicio 1 Realizar una aplicación que genere los cinco números de la loto (esto es cinco números aleatorios entre 1 y 99 no repetidos)
Profesor Hermann Pempelfort Vergara. Sentencias IF  Es una decisión, ES o NO ES, al igual que en Excel.  If condicion Then ○ Acción  Else ○ Acción.
Curso de formación de Microsoft® Office Excel® 2007
Franco Caviglia Catenazzi. Ejercicio nº1  Ingresar un número cualquiera e informar si es positivo, negativo o nulo. C Negativo Positivo Nulo A A>0 0
Programación Visual Basic
ESTRUCTURAS DE CONTROL SELECTIVA LUIS OCTAVIO BUSTAMANTE Docente Colegio de la UPB.
Variables y pruebas de escritorio
4: Control de flujo Condicionales y bucles
1 Procedimientos Es un conjunto de sentencias incluidas entre las declaraciones Sub o Function y End Sub/Function VB utiliza varios tipos de procedimientos:
Computación Aplicada Ma. Teresa García Ramírez
Dim VARIABLE As TIPODATO Dim int As Integer = 0 VARIABLE= InputBox(“Digite el Documento a buscar") While Not NOMBRETABLA.EOF And int = 0 If NOMBRETABLA.Fields(0).Value.
 Ingresar dos valores correspondientes a la edad de una persona. Informar "La primera persona es mayor", "La segunda persona es mayor". C E 1 E 2 E1>E2.
Clase 4 Informática Profa. María Alejandra Quintero.
Trabajo Practico 2 Nombre: Indira Diana. Ejercicio numero 1 C C Numero = 0 Numero > 0 numero positivo nulo negativo F F Verdadero Ingresar un número cualquiera.
Private Sub CommandButton1_Click() Dim n As Integer For n = 1 To 20 Range("a1").Cells(n, 1) = Int(100 * Rnd() + 1) If Range("a1").Cells(n, 1) Mod 5 = 0.
Ejercicio N°4 Ingresar dos números enteros cualesquiera. Informar "el primero es mayor que el segundo", "el segundo es mayor que el primero" o "son iguales"
Ejercicio N°5 Ingresar cuatro números cualesquiera, si su suma es mayor a 15 elevarlo al cuadrado, si no, elevarlo al cubo. C Número1 (n1) Número2 (n2)
Tema 7. Introducción a lenguaje de programación Visual Basic (clase 1)
M.C. Martha Cárdenas HERRAMIENTAS PRODUCTIVAS II Introducción a la Programación.
Luis Alberto Contreras Pinzón Docente
Variables y Shapes. Variables ► Lugares de la memoria que reciben un nombre ► En VB no es necesario declarar las variables  A=8 ► Se declaran con Dim.
Computación Aplicada Facultad de Ingeniería Universidad Autónoma de Querétaro Ma. Teresa García Ramírez 1.
Microsoft© Visual Basic . Net.
Trabajo Práctico 2 Agustin Arias 1ºB. Ejercicio 1 Ingresar un número cualquiera e informar si es positivo, negativo o nulo.
Funciones especiales y Select case Visual basic consola
Laboratorio Informática II Clase 5 Excel Controles Active X.
Visual basic CLASE III. Dimensionar – Crear Variables Tipos de Variables: - Integer: Números Enteros - Double: Números con punto flotante - String: Cadena.
TRABAJO PRACTICO Nº2 Nombre: Ignacio D. Roca. Ejercicio Nº 1 TP 2 C numero numero= 0 Numero> 0 negativo f nulo verdadero positivo falso.
Clase 2 Informática Profa. María Alejandra Quintero.
Camila Rodríguez 1º B. DIAGRAMA: PANTALLA: PROGRAMACION Private Sub CommandButton1_Click() Dim NumeroA As Integer Label1 = "ingrese un numero" NumeroA.
Do Una o más instrucciones Loop until expresión lógica Tema 9. Estructuras de repetición “Repetir Hasta” Sintaxis de la estructura “repetir hasta” en Visual.
Fundamentos de Excel Microsoft Excel 2010.
Clase 4 Informática Profa. María Alejandra Quintero.
Tema 10. Uso de formularios y controles
Clase 2 Informática Profa. María Alejandra Quintero.
Visual Basic Visual Basic 6.0 es un programa que consiste en la programación en lenguaje Basic en un entorno visual de manejo.
Microsoft Excel 2010 Fundamentos de Excel.
Elementos de la pantalla. Barra de Títulos: Muestra el Icono del programa, el nombre de la aplicación activa, el nombre del archivo y ubica los botones.
Laboratorio Informática II Clase 3 Excel Macros. Tablas Que es una Macro? Con las macros lo que se pretende es automatizar varias tareas y fusionarlas.
Práctico Mercedes Alonso. Ejercicio 0 C Numero A Numero A>5 “No” F “Sí” (textbox) Salida (label) IF Verdadero Falso Ingresar un número cualquiera e informar.
Clase 3 Informática Profa. María Alejandra Quintero.
Laboratorio Informática I Clase 7 EXCEL. Excel Una Planilla de cálculo es una herramienta útil para efectuar cálculos, gráficos, estadísticas, resúmenes,
EXCEL 2013 DEFINICION PARTES FUNDAMENTALES DIBUJOS EXCEL VIDEO
Formas de acceder a Excel 2013 por medio de Windows 8
Tema 9. Estructuras de repetición “Repetir Mientras”
Programación Visual Basic ‍2º año B ‍Nombre: javier vasaquez ‍Computadora Número:25.
Laboratorio Informática II
CONCEPTOS BASICOS EXCEL 2007
Laboratorio Informática II
Práctico Mercedes Alonso. Ejercicio 0 C Numero A Numero A>5 “No” F “Sí” (textbox) Salida (label) IF Verdadero Falso Ingresar un número cualquiera e informar.
Módulo 4: Trabajando con Procedimientos. Descripción Crear procedimientos Uso de procedimientos Uso de funciones predefinidas Debug and Deploy Escribir.
CREAR PROCEDIMIENTO DE COMBOBOX LLENAR EDAD Private Sub Cargar_Edad( ) cboEdad.AddItem ("5") cboEdad.AddItem ("6") cboEdad.AddItem ("7") cboEdad.AddItem.
Conceptos.  Byte (0 a 255) = un byte  Short ( a ) = 16 bits de longitud  Integer ( a ) = 32 bits de longitud 
QUÈ ES VISUAL ESTUDIO ES UN LENGUAJE DE PROGRAMACIÒN QUE SE HA DISEÑADO PARA FACILITAR EL DESARROLLO DE APLICACIONES EN EL ENTORNO GRÀFICO. (GUI GRAPHICAL.
3era. Clase ramo informática aplicada Planilla de calculo.
Cuadros de Diálogo. Cuadros de Mensaje Titulo Mensaje Botones Icono.
QUÈ ES VISUAL ESTUDIO ES UN LENGUAJE DE PROGRAMACIÒN QUE SE HA DISEÑADO PARA FACILITAR EL DESARROLLO DE APLICACIONES EN EL ENTORNO GRÀFICO. OBJETIVO:
VB(lab1) Operacionas Básicas. VB(lab1) Realizar un programa que pida 2 números al usuario y que muestre el la suma de los dos por pantalla. Private Sub.
Programación en Visual Basic
BARRA DE ACCESO RAPIDO BARRA DE TITULOS BARRA DE COMANDOS BARRA DE FORMULAS CUADRO DE NOMBRES HOJA DE CALCULO PESTAÑA DE HOJAS NUEVAS BARRA DE ESTADO BARRA.
Gianfranco Barbalace 1 año “B”.  Ingresar un número cualquiera e informar si es positivo, negativo o nulo. C C Número = 0 Número Número > 0 Nulo Verdadero.
Laboratorio Informática II Clase 9 Ejercicios. Ejercicio 1 Indique cuál es el Camino Crítico del siguiente Proyecto
CREAR PROCEDIMIENTO DE COMBOBOX LLENAR EDAD Private Sub Cargar_Edad( ) cboEdad.AddItem ("5") cboEdad.AddItem ("6") cboEdad.AddItem ("7") cboEdad.AddItem.
Prof. Jonathan Silva Ingeniería Civil – Informática I Ingeniería Civil Informática I Clase 5.
Bucles For&NextBucles DoEl control TimerReferencia Rápida.
Control, adquisición y monitoreo con Arduino y Visual Basic .net
Titulo Sub. Titulo Texto Titulo Texto Titulo Texto.
Excel Macros Formularios.
Excel Macros Fórmulas.
Transcripción de la presentación:

Laboratorio Informática II Clase 5 Excel Controles Active X Repaso Macros

Tablas 1.Modo diseño: permitirá trabajar en el diseño de los controles de ActiveX 2.Propiedades: permiten activar la propiedad de cada control 3.Ver código: permite agregar código a cada control.

Ejercicio. Propiedades 1.Hacemos estas hojas: Menú, Ventas y Compras 2. En la hoja Manu: Inserte dos botones ActiveX 3. Cambie las propiedades de los dos botones: Cambie en propiedades Caption y Name 4.Ver codigo del boton y agregar segun corresponda Hoja2.Activate Hacer lo mismo con el segundo Desactivar modo disenio y probar

Formulas Locales Range("C3").FormulaLocal = "=SUMA(D6:D7)” O Range(“C3").Select ActiveCell.FormulaLocal = "=SUMA(D6:D7)"

Insertar Sub insertar() ' ' cambio Macro ' ' Acceso directo: CTRL+j ' Sheets("Hoja1").Select Range("d6:f6").Select Selection.Copy Sheets("Hoja2").Select Range("d6:f6").Select ActiveSheet.Paste Selection.EntireRow.Insert End Sub

Variables e Input DIM variable AS tipo. InputBox(Mensaje, Título, Valor por defecto, Posición horizontal, Posición Vertical, Archivo ayuda, Número de contexto para la ayuda). Sub Entrar_Valor Dim Texto As String ' Chr(13) sirve para que el mensaje se muestre en dos Líneas Texto = InputBox("Introducir un texto " & Chr(13) & "Para la celda A1", "Entrada de datos") ActiveSheet.Range("A1").Value = Texto End Sub

Variables Sub Entrar_Valor Dim Celda As String Dim Texto As String Celda = InputBox("En que celda quiere entrar el valor", "Entrar Celda") Texto = InputBox("Introducir un texto " & Chr(13) & "Para la celda " & Celda, "Entrada de datos") ActiveSheet.Range(Celda).Value = Texto End Sub

Tipos de Datos Byte Boolean Integer Single Date String

Condicionales If Condición Then Senténcia1 Senténcia2. SenténciaN End If Select Case signo Case "+“ Total = 10. Case Else Total = 0 End Select